Transaction 2cbcd4def12f043e68e7b3aab8b0c33ff2459718e2380212c070c6ea18068a2e

3 Input
1 Outputs
  • 2cbcd4def12f043e68e7b3aab8b0c33ff2459718e2380212c070c6ea18068a2e:0
  • value  68730000
    address  35thTbKyXY5Z959unEyXDq15WARRymJadZ